Cargo tank pressure valves in marine fuel systems regulate internal pressure to ensure safe operations. They prevent overpressure or vacuum conditions that could damage tanks or pipelines. These valves are critical for maintaining system integrity and environmental compliance.
Size: Typically ranges from 1/2" to 4" nominal bore.
Grade: ASTM A216 WCB, ASTM A351 CF8, or equivalent marine-grade materials.
Viscosity: Compatible with fuels ranging from 1 cSt (light distillates) to 700 cSt (heavy fuel oil).
Buoyancy: Not applicable; designed for pressure regulation, not buoyant properties.
Material: Body—carbon steel, stainless steel (316/304); Seals—Viton, PTFE, or NBR.
Pressure Rating: 150 PSI to 600 PSI (standard), higher ratings available for specialized systems.
Temperature Range: -20°C to 200°C (-4°F to 392°F), depending on material and seal type.
Certifications: ABS, DNV, LR, or other class society approvals for marine use.
Connection Type: Flanged, threaded, or welded, per ANSI/ASME standards.
Leakage Class: ANSI/FCI 70-2 Class IV or higher for tight shut-off.
Cargo Tank Pressure Valves and Marine Fuel Systems typically comply with maritime standards such as IMO SOLAS, MARPOL, and classification society rules like ABS, DNV, or LR. Verify specific product certifications for exact compliance.
